(Penn Mutual Indemnity Co. v. C.I.R., 227 F.2d 16, 19-20 (3rd Cir. 1960).) All the other taxes are typically called "indirect taxes," because they tax an event, rather than person or property as such. (Steward Machine Co. v. Davis, 301 U.S. 548, 581-582 (1937).) What was a straightforward limitation on the power of the legislature based on the main topics the tax proved inexact and unclear when applied to an income tax, which could be arguably viewed either as a direct or lanciao an indirect tax.
